Публикации по теме 'nestjs'


Динамические источники данных в NestJS с внедрением зависимостей — Factory Pattern
NestJS — это мощная платформа, которая превосходно реализует внедрение зависимостей. Однако, когда дело доходит до индивидуальных сценариев, таких как динамическое переключение источников данных, нам нужно копнуть глубже и изучить наши варианты. Испытание Представьте себе сценарий, в котором у вас есть несколько источников данных, таких как базы данных или внешние API, и вам необходимо динамически переключаться между ними на основе параметров запроса в URL-адресе. Это может быть легко..

Начало работы с NestJS
Почему вам стоит подумать о NestJS для вашего следующего проекта Это первая часть серии статей о фреймворке Node.js, известном как NestJS . В этой статье мы увидим, почему и как использовать NestJS. Моя история Node.js Я использую Express.js с 2017 года, и мне нравится Express.js - он хорошо спроектирован, и мы можем подключить любую библиотеку JavaScript и использовать ее. Я долгое время был разработчиком .Net и сейчас работаю с Angular. При работе с ExpressJS мне не хватает..

Nest.JS выше других
Если вы работаете с Node.JS , вы должны знать, что существует несколько фреймворков, которые вы можете использовать, и это приводит к общей путанице в отношении того, какой фреймворк следует выбрать и использовать. Теперь, выпустив слона в комнату, мы обсудим Nest.JS и его конкурирующие фреймворки. Начнем с основного вопроса "Что такое Nest.JS?" Nest.JS — одна из самых быстроразвивающихся платформ для Node.JS, Это открытый исходный код, расширяемый, универсальный и..

Раскрытие возможностей Nest JS: простое руководство по легкой бэкэнд-разработке
Добро пожаловать в мир легкой серверной разработки с Nest JS! В этом захватывающем путешествии мы узнаем, как Nest JS революционизирует создание серверных проектов, делая его проще, чем когда-либо прежде. В отличие от других фреймворков, которые утопают в шаблонном коде даже для простого примера «Hello World», Nest JS упрощает процесс, автоматизируя рутинные задачи, позволяя вам сосредоточиться на сути вашего приложения. Благодаря своим комплексным решениям для основных внутренних..

Гнездо.JS | Монады -> Либо
Гнездо.JS | Монады -> Либо Монада Either , также известная как монада Result , представляет собой монаду, которая используется для представления вычислений, которые могут иметь один из двух возможных результатов: значение типа Left или значение типа Right . Тип Left обычно используется для представления ошибки или сбоя, а тип Right используется для представления успешного вычисления. Монада Either обычно реализуется как объект, имеющий два подтипа: Left и Right ...

Объект в JavaScript: обзор
Объекты используются для хранения коллекций различных данных и более сложных сущностей с ключами. В JavaScript объекты проникают почти во все аспекты языка. Поэтому мы должны сначала понять их, прежде чем углубляться в что-либо еще. Объект можно создать с фигурными скобками {…} с необязательным списком свойств . Свойство — это пара «ключ: значение», где key — это строка (также называемая «именем свойства»), а value может быть чем угодно. Мы можем представить объект как шкаф..

Бессерверное приложение NestJS с MongoDB Atlas
Как отмечает AWS, Serverless - это экономичный способ создания и развертывания приложений, вы можете создать серверное приложение любого типа и использовать преимущества шлюза API для подключения своего внешнего интерфейса или любого другого сервиса, который вам нужен. Это руководство предназначено для создания бессерверного приложения с NestJS, Serverless и MondoDB Atlas в среде AWS. Чтобы прояснить, я собираюсь использовать изображения для публикации кода, я предпочитаю этот способ,..